引言
随着科技的飞速发展,生态环境监测行业正经历着一场变革。新型代码技术的应用,为生态环境监测提供了更加精准、高效的数据处理和分析手段。本文将深入解析绿色守护在生态环境监测领域的应用,探讨新代码如何助力我国生态环境监测事业。
一、绿色守护概述
绿色守护是一款专注于生态环境监测的软件,通过收集、处理和分析各类环境数据,为政府部门、科研机构和企事业单位提供决策依据。该软件具有以下特点:
- 数据采集全面:绿色守护可实时采集空气、水质、土壤、噪音等环境数据。
- 数据处理高效:采用先进的算法对海量数据进行处理,提高数据准确性。
- 分析结果直观:以图表、报表等形式展示分析结果,便于用户理解。
二、新代码在绿色守护中的应用
- 大数据处理技术
绿色守护运用大数据处理技术,对海量环境数据进行实时采集、存储和分析。以下是一段示例代码,展示了如何使用Python进行数据采集和处理:
import requests
import pandas as pd
# 数据采集
def collect_data(url):
response = requests.get(url)
data = response.json()
return data
# 数据处理
def process_data(data):
df = pd.DataFrame(data)
df['timestamp'] = pd.to_datetime(df['timestamp'])
return df
# 示例:采集空气质量数据
url = "http://api.example.com/air_quality"
data = collect_data(url)
processed_data = process_data(data)
print(processed_data)
- 人工智能技术
绿色守护运用人工智能技术,对环境数据进行智能分析,预测环境变化趋势。以下是一段示例代码,展示了如何使用Python进行机器学习:
from sklearn.linear_model import LinearRegression
import pandas as pd
# 数据准备
data = pd.read_csv("air_quality_data.csv")
X = data[['timestamp', 'temperature', 'humidity']]
y = data['pm2.5']
# 模型训练
model = LinearRegression()
model.fit(X, y)
# 预测
new_data = pd.DataFrame({'timestamp': ['2022-01-01'], 'temperature': [10], 'humidity': [80]})
predicted_pm2_5 = model.predict(new_data)
print(predicted_pm2_5)
- 云计算技术
绿色守护采用云计算技术,实现数据存储、处理和分析的分布式部署。以下是一段示例代码,展示了如何使用Python进行云计算:
from azure.storage.blob import BlobServiceClient
# 创建Blob服务客户端
connection_string = "your_connection_string"
blob_service_client = BlobServiceClient.from_connection_string(connection_string)
# 创建容器
container_name = "your_container_name"
blob_service_client.create_container(container_name)
# 上传文件
blob_name = "your_file_name.csv"
blob_client = blob_service_client.get_blob_client(container_name, blob_name)
with open("your_file_name.csv", "rb") as data:
blob_client.upload_blob(data)
三、绿色守护的应用价值
- 提高监测效率:绿色守护可实时监测环境数据,提高监测效率。
- 精准分析:新代码技术助力绿色守护对环境数据进行精准分析,为决策提供有力支持。
- 降低成本:绿色守护采用云计算技术,降低环境监测成本。
四、总结
绿色守护作为生态环境监测行业的新代码代表,在提高监测效率、精准分析和降低成本等方面发挥着重要作用。随着新代码技术的不断进步,绿色守护将为我国生态环境监测事业带来更多惊喜。
